Executioner Treefrog vs Lacustrine Vole
Dendropsophus carnifex compared with Microtus limnophilus
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Executioner Treefrog | Lacustrine Vole |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(animal) | Animalia (animal)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Amphibia (amphibien) | Mammalia (mammifères) |
| Order | Anura (anoures)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Hylidae |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Dendropsophus | Microtus |
| Species | Dendropsophus carnifex | Microtus limnophilus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Executioner Treefrog and Lacustrine Vole share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
